Proyectos «Europa Excelencia» (EUR)
Funds Spanish research teams converting strong European Research Council evaluations into domestic projects.
Proyectos Europa Excelencia sits under AEI's research-and-development programme and exists to keep Spanish teams in play after a strong ERC evaluation that missed funding for budgetary reasons. It backs Starting, Consolidator, and Advanced Grant proposals that were considered eligible by the European Research Council but did not receive money. The 2026 call is a 2.5 million euro competitive subsidy and is aimed at raising Spain's return rate in Horizon Europe Pillar 1. The route is open to public or private non-profit research organisations in Spain with the capacity to execute meaningful research and turn ERC-quality ideas into funded work. It can pay for staff, small equipment, materials, and other project costs tied to the proposal's objectives. Applications are handled in Spanish, and the call runs on an annual cycle. This programme works best as a bridge, not as a standalone concept: the underlying project has already passed ERC scrutiny, so the real task is to convert that validation into a financed Spanish project. AEI uses Europa Excelencia to keep excellent proposals alive, protect investigator momentum, and improve national conversion from ERC evaluation to domestic support. The strongest proposals will already look like serious ERC-level science, with a clear plan for how the Spanish grant will carry it forward.
